If you cannot afford Obamacare, see if you can qualify for the state-based insurance program called Medicaid.  Your Obamacare application can help you determine if you qualify for Medicaid.

A premium is the amount you pay for your health insurance every month. In addition to your premium, you usually have to pay other costs for your health care, including a deductible, copayments, and coinsurance. If you have a Marketplace health plan, you may be able to lower your costs with a premium tax credit.

A health insurance copay (or copayment) is a set fee you pay for a doctor visit or prescription. You usually pay it at your appointment or when you pick up a prescription.

Outside Open Enrollment, you can only get individual health insurance two ways:

  • With a Special Enrollment Period.  You can qualify if you lose job-based coverage, have a baby, get married or divorced, or have certain other life changes.
  • Through Medicaid or the Children’s Health Insurance Program.  You can apply any time and can enroll immediately if you’re eligible.

A Special Enrollment Period or SEP is a time outside the yearly Open Enrollment Period when you can sign up for health insurance.  You qualify for a Special Enrollment Period if you’ve had certain life events, including losing health coverage, moving, getting married or divorced, having a baby, adopting a child, or if your household income is below a certain amount.

The Affordable Care Act, also known as Obamacare, gives most uninsured people in the U.S. access to health insurance as long as they are U.S. citizens who live in the country, are not incarcerated, and are not covered by Medicare. Some may qualify for financial assistance or tax credits on the plan’s premium depending on your state and income.

There are two main types of individual and family health insurance or ACA plans.  These include HMO and PPO plans.  A PPO (Preferred Provider Organization) plan encourages you to use insurance company’s network of preferred doctors and hospitals, but will provide some out of network coverage.  HMO plans (Health Maintenance Organization) usually provide members lower out-of-pocket health care expenses but they provide less physicians and hospital options.
